🥘 Ingredients

14 items
  • 500 grams Ground chicken
  • 2 tablespoons Ghee
  • 1 medium, finely chopped Onion
  • 1 tablespoon Ginger garlic paste
  • 1 medium, finely chopped Green chili
  • 1 medium, finely chopped Tomato
  • 1 teaspoon Cumin powder
  • 1 teaspoon Coriander powder
  • 0.5 teaspoon Turmeric powder
  • 0.5 teaspoon Garam masala
  • 1 teaspoon Salt
  • 2 tablespoons, chopped Fresh cilantro
  • 1 tablespoon Lemon juice
  • 100 ml Water

📝 Instructions

11 steps
1

Heat 2 tablespoons of ghee in a large non-stick pan over medium heat.

2

Add the finely chopped onion to the pan and sauté for 4-5 minutes until they become translucent.

3

Stir in 1 tablespoon of ginger garlic paste and 1 finely chopped green chili. Cook for another 1-2 minutes until the raw smell disappears.

4

Add 1 medium finely chopped tomato to the pan and cook until the tomatoes become soft and the oil begins to separate from the mixture, about 3-4 minutes.

5

Mix in 1 teaspoon cumin powder, 1 teaspoon coriander powder, 0.5 teaspoon turmeric powder, and 1 teaspoon salt. Stir well for 1-2 minutes for the spices to release their aroma.

6

Add the 500 grams of ground chicken to the pan and mix thoroughly with the spice mixture, ensuring the chicken is evenly coated.

7

Cook for 5-7 minutes on medium heat until the chicken changes color and is cooked through.

8

Pour in 100 ml of water, bring the mixture to a simmer, and cover the pan. Let it cook for 10 minutes on low-medium heat, stirring occasionally.

9

Remove the lid, add 0.5 teaspoon of garam masala, and stir well. Cook uncovered for another 3-5 minutes to let the flavors meld.

10

Turn off the heat, add 2 tablespoons of chopped fresh cilantro and 1 tablespoon of lemon juice to the keema, and stir well.

11

Serve the keto chicken keema hot, garnished with a little extra cilantro if desired. Enjoy!
